2.1 Requesting Help
When you experience a tire problem, the first step is to request roadside assistance. Many roadside help companies offer mobile apps or dedicated hotlines for immediate service. You can simply provide your location, a brief description of the issue, and any other relevant details. In some cases, you may also be able to request the type of service you need, whether it’s a tire change or flat tire assistance.
2.2 Dispatching Assistance
Once your request is submitted, the nearest available technician or service provider is dispatched to your location. The company will typically use GPS technology to find the quickest route to your position, ensuring minimal waiting time. Depending on the time of day and the location, help can arrive within 30 minutes to an hour, making this service a quick solution for emergency tire issues.
2.3 Tire Repair or Replacement
When the technician arrives, they will assess the situation. If the tire is repairable, they will perform the necessary repairs, such as patching a punctured tire or replacing a valve. If the tire is beyond repair, they will replace it with your spare tire or offer to take your vehicle to a nearby shop for a more thorough replacement. Many roadside assistance services also carry common tire sizes, ensuring they have the right tire to get you back on the road in case of an emergency.
3. Types of Tire Issues Addressed by 24/7 Roadside Help
24/7 roadside assistance services can address a variety of tire-related problems. These services are designed to handle a wide range of situations, from minor issues to more significant tire emergencies:
3.1 Flat Tire Assistance
One of the most common reasons people need roadside help is a flat tire. Whether caused by a nail, debris, or natural wear and tear, a flat tire can leave you stranded on the side of the road. Roadside assistance teams can quickly change your tire or provide a temporary fix to get you to a nearby service station.
3.2 Blowouts
A blowout is a more serious tire problem that occurs when a tire bursts suddenly, often due to a puncture, under-inflation, or excessive speed. Blowouts can be dangerous, especially if they happen on highways or high-speed roads. Immediate roadside assistance is essential to ensure your safety. Tow trucks or mobile tire services are equipped to replace the tire or tow your vehicle to a safer location for a full inspection.
3.3 Punctures
Punctures caused by nails, screws, or sharp objects are another common tire problem. Roadside technicians can patch the tire or temporarily seal it until you reach a repair shop. In some cases, tire puncture repair is enough to get you back on your way, while in others, a replacement may be necessary.
3.4 Valve Stem or Tire Pressure Issues
Issues with tire pressure or valve stems can also cause problems while driving. Low tire pressure can lead to decreased fuel efficiency, uneven tire wear, and potentially dangerous driving conditions. Roadside assistance services can check the tire pressure, fix faulty valve stems, or inflate tires to the correct pressure.
3.5 Towing Services for Unrepairable Tires
Sometimes, a tire issue is too severe to be repaired on-site. In these cases, towing services are often included as part of roadside assistance. If your tire is damaged beyond repair and you have no spare, the technician will tow your vehicle to a nearby garage or tire shop for a proper replacement.
